There is no fully objective answer to this question. Many chemists would consider that two lanthanide elements with atomic numbers differing by only one would be likely to qualify. Another possibility is the pair zirconium and hafnium. These are very similar in most chemical characteristics but differ greatly in electron capture tendencies in nuclear reactors.
